Procedure for Breast Cancer Treatment

A once common procedure for breast cancer treatment was the radical mastectomy involving the removal of the entire breast, axillary lymph nodes, as well as both Pectoralis muscles. The Pectoralis muscles have multiple functions including adduction, protraction, internal rotation and flexion at the shoulder.
